George W. Bush
(Incompetence, Terrorism, National Security)
FACT:
The seven Democrats and seven Republicans serving on the Hart-Rudman Commission,
which had been put together in 1998 by then-President Bill Clinton and
then-House Speaker Newt Gingrich, R-Ga., to make sweeping strategic recommendations
on how the United States could ensure its security in the 21st century,
delivered their report to the Bush administration, with 50 unanimously
approved recommendations. The commission recommended the formation of a
Cabinet-level position to combat terrorism. The proposed National Homeland
Security Agency director would have "responsibility for planning, coordinating,
and integrating various U.S. government activities involved in homeland
security," according to the commission's executive summary. Other recommendations:
U.S. foreign policy should strive to shape an international system in which
just grievances can be addressed without violence. Verifiable arms control
and nonproliferation efforts must remain a top priority to help persuade
states and terrorists to abjure weapons of mass destruction. The development
of new transportation security procedures and practices was urged. Said
Gary Hart, "We said Americans will likely die on American soil, possibly
in large numbers - that's a quote (from the commission's Phase One Report)."
The Bush administration does nothing.
